8. Clean the valve guide bores with a suitable tool. Remove all carbon or dirt from the bores.
The valve guide must be clean for the seat grinding tool to obtain proper results.
9. Grind the valve seat.
The recommendations of the manufacturer of the equipment should be followed carefully to obtain the
proper results. Regardless of what type of equipment is used, it is essential that valve guide bores be free
from carbon or dirt to ensure proper centering of the tool pilot in the guide.
10. Inspect the valve seats.
z
The valve seats should be concentric to within 0.05 mm (0.0021 in) total indicator reading.
z
If the valve seat has been ground, it may be necessary to shim the valve spring to attain the proper
spring installed height.
